Cured13 wrote:. Give us some pointers what to be aware off when deciding about choosing a Paint Shop and how to find out who is not bull ****ting me with phoney promisess of the best finish in town etc. What to ask for material vise and technique vise. I allready know one answer - "depend how much you want to spend"but I also know that the higher price do not always guarantee good job done.
The best way to know what shop does good quality work is to talk to people at local car shows and cruise ins. even if you have to go to hot rod shows. The cars with custom paint jobs and resprays are usually obvious, ask the owners who did the work and how reasonable are the prices. You will almost never get a good paint job cheap. but expensive doesn't always mean good. a shop's best representation are its prior customers and how well the work was done and holds up (paint chipping/ peeling etc).
